Terry J. Reedy added the comment: This issue is essentially a duplicate of $4832, in which Ned Deily added 'defaultextension' in the code below. Saving works fine on Windows, The added default extension is not shown in the input box of the SaveAs dialog but it is visible in file listing or in the IDLE editor title bar. Ned said that with the his addition, it also worked on OSX. Are you sure there is no extension in a file listing or title bar if you don't add .py? What tcl/tk version are you using?
